2-METHYL-1-PENTADECENE

Base Information Edit
  • Chemical Name:2-METHYL-1-PENTADECENE
  • CAS No.:29833-69-0
  • Molecular Formula:C16H32
  • Molecular Weight:224.43

Chemical Property of 2-METHYL-1-PENTADECENE Edit
Chemical Property:
  • Vapor Pressure:0.00475mmHg at 25°C 
  • Melting Point:-6.57°C 
  • Refractive Index:1.4405 
  • Boiling Point:285.7°C at 760 mmHg 
  • Flash Point:126°C 
  • PSA:0.00000 
  • Density:0.78g/cm3 
  • LogP:6.26360

synthetic route:
Guidance literature:
With Pd(P(t-Bu)2Me)2; potassium tert-butylate; N-cyclohexyl-cyclohexanamine; In 1,4-dioxane; at 20 ℃; for 24h; Concentration; Kinetics; Inert atmosphere;
DOI:10.1021/ja306323x
Guidance literature:
With Pd(P(t-Bu)2Me)2; potassium tert-butylate; N-cyclohexyl-cyclohexanamine; In 1,4-dioxane; at 80 ℃; for 8h; Inert atmosphere;
DOI:10.1021/ja306323x
Guidance literature:
Multi-step reaction with 5 steps
1.1: sodium hydride / tetrahydrofuran / 0 °C / Inert atmosphere
1.2: 20 °C / Inert atmosphere
2.1: 10% Pd/C; hydrogen / methanol / 18 h / 20 °C / 760.05 Torr
3.1: lithium aluminium tetrahydride / diethyl ether / 0 - 20 h
4.1: dmap; triethylamine / dichloromethane / 0 - 20 °C / Inert atmosphere
5.1: Pd(P(t-Bu)2Me)2; potassium tert-butylate; N-cyclohexyl-cyclohexanamine / 1,4-dioxane / 8 h / 80 °C / Inert atmosphere
With dmap; lithium aluminium tetrahydride; Pd(P(t-Bu)2Me)2; 10% Pd/C; potassium tert-butylate; hydrogen; sodium hydride; triethylamine; N-cyclohexyl-cyclohexanamine; In tetrahydrofuran; 1,4-dioxane; methanol; diethyl ether; dichloromethane;
DOI:10.1021/ja306323x
